What are some common challenges faced by Remote RF Communications Engineers and how can they be addressed?

Remote RF Communications Engineers often encounter challenges such as diagnosing signal interference issues without on-site access, coordinating with geographically dispersed teams, and ensuring reliable communication links across varied environments. To address these challenges, engineers rely heavily on remote monitoring tools, clear documentation, and regular virtual meetings with cross-functional teams. Building strong communication skills and staying updated with the latest diagnostic software can greatly enhance effectiveness in a remote setting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ote RF Communications Engineer, and why are they important?

A Remote RF Communications Engineer requires solid knowledge of radio frequency theory, wireless communication systems, and typically a degree in electrical or electronics engineering. Familiarity with simulation tools like MATLAB, RF test equipment, and certifications such as FCC licensure or Cisco CCNA Wireless are often necessary.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ving abilities, and effective remote collaboration skills help set top performers apart. These competencies ensure reliable design, troubleshooting, and optimization of complex wireless networks from remote locations.

What are Remote RF Communications Engineers?

Remote RF Communications Engineers are professionals who design, implement, and maintain radio frequency (RF) communication systems while working from a remote location. They are responsible for optimizing wireless signals, troubleshooting connectivity issues, and ensuring that communication networks meet performance standards. These engineers often collaborate with teams virtually to analyze data, configure equipment, and support the deployment of wireless infrastructure for applications such as cellular networks, satellite communications, and IoT devices. Their work is critical for enabling reliable wireless communication in various industries.
